African French French: français africain is a generic make-up of the varieties of the French language spoken by an estimated 141 million people in Africa in 2018, spread across 34 countries & territories. This includes those who speak French as a first or second language in these 34 African countries & territories dark and light blue on the map, but it does not include French speakers living in other African countries. Africa is thus the continent with the almost French speakers in the world. French arrived in Africa as a colonial language; these African French speakers are now a large part of the Francophonie.
